In situ ultrasound enhancement of octanoic acid directional solvent extraction for seawater desalination
The low yield and high salinity of the water product have limited the use of directional solvent extraction desalination method to the treatment of only low salinity water. In this research, in situ ultrasound enhancement of octanoic acid solvent extraction desalination is reported. The pre-prepared...
